How much does a nanny cost in Minneapolis, MN?

  • Average weekly cost for 1 child: $806.40/wk
  • Average weekly cost for 2 children: $947.20/wk
  • Part-time nanny weekly cost (1 child): $504.00/wk
  • Typical annual salary for full-time nanny in Minneapolis, MN: $41,932.80/yr

As of July 2026

Do I need a nanny contract?

A written agreement helps you and your nanny align on schedule, pay, duties, and time off before the job begins. Many families in Minneapolis use a simple contract to set expectations from day one. See our nanny contract template and guide for what to include.
